Is 2009 Ford Mustang a good car?

Is the 2009 Ford Mustang a good car?
Based on the search results, the 2009 Ford Mustang generally receives positive reviews. Here are some key points to consider:
– Reliability and Maintenance: Owners report that the 2009 Ford Mustang is easy to maintain and work on, with no major mechanical problems. It is also described as a reliable car that is enjoyable to drive.
– Performance: The Mustang GT model, equipped with a V8 engine, offers strong acceleration and a sonorous exhaust note. The handling is praised, with good balance and responsiveness.
– Safety: The 2009 Ford Mustang has a good safety rating, receiving a perfect overall 5-star rating in government crash tests. However, it received 4 stars in rear passenger side crash tests.
– Interior and Comfort: The front seats are comfortable, but the backseats are cramped and not ideal for long drives. The base model has some hard plastic in the interior, but the overall styling is liked.
– Cargo Space: The coupe model offers above-average cargo space with 13.1 cubic feet, while the convertible has a smaller trunk space with 9.7 cubic feet.
Overall, the 2009 Ford Mustang is considered an entertaining and satisfying car, with a good balance of performance and reliability. It is important to note that individual experiences may vary, so it is recommended to test drive the car and consider personal preferences before making a decision.

Is Mustang maintenance high?

The average total annual cost for repairs and maintenance on a Ford Mustang is $709, compared to an average of $526 for midsize cars and $652 for all vehicle models.

What years of Mustang are good?

  • 2005-2010 gt with the 4.6L. These engines have been shown to be extremely reliable and can easily hit over 200k and some people even hitting 400k.
  • 2015-2017 gt. This gets the second spot due to having upgraded engine components.
  • 2011-2014 gt. This was the first year of the modern 5.0.
